Research Abstract |
Immunohistological examination revealed that Indoleamine 2,3 dioxygenase(IDO) positive cells in glioblastoma(GBM) tissue overlap the cells which construct the characteristic structure indicating GBM. The sphere cells (brain tumor stem cells: BTSC) enriched by the sphere culture method from the GBM patient showed high IDO reactivity on not only level of gene expression but also the enzyme activity compared with diffenretiated cells from sphere cells by serum stimulation. These data support IDO targeted strategy for BTSC in GBM treatment will be highly effective coupled with the fact that IDO inhibition may restore host's immune response against GBM.
